Output d2fb088ba4bd05a0ea5cff2a4fa467cbcef4f116ebd89a151c6563965e7945c3:1

value
12801211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b1c0a5cb4a094e663440c0aa77a6b4adae0bbb OP_EQUAL
address
3NuPdWaFZ37UofnGUTPULMwboVTsTwcNVd
transaction
d2fb088ba4bd05a0ea5cff2a4fa467cbcef4f116ebd89a151c6563965e7945c3
confirmations
101153
spent
true